I agree -- and it's now called the "Performance Pack" versus "Track Pack" because it's really more of a performance street/road setup than it is a "Track Pack" -- granted the some options are better for the strip, some are better for the track -- but the sum of all the parts for the Performance Pack is really a blend of all of those needs -- maybe with a slight tilt towards road work versus the strip.

My DIBlue base PP car with Recaros.. just like everyone else's, 20% tint, getting the windshield tinted tomorrow. Already has a tune, K&N drop in filter, Airaid CAI tube, MBRP race cat back exhaust, Steeda sub frame bushings. Ordering the Eibach Pro kit, BMR F&R sway bars, LT's and o/r mid pipe, 19x10 PP knock off wheels for the rear and 305/35r19 drag radials in a couple weeks, then I will switch it to E85. :D
